Acute Attack of Migraine - Management
Overview
The goal of acute migraine treatment is rapid, complete, and consistent relief with minimal side effects. Treatment must be individualized - no single approach works for all patients - and should begin as early as possible after attack onset, ideally at first symptom or during aura.
Five major drug classes are used:
- NSAIDs
- 5-HT1B/1D agonists (triptans)
- CGRP receptor antagonists (gepants)
- 5-HT1F agonists (ditans)
- Dopamine receptor antagonists (antiemetics)
Step-Wise Approach by Severity
Mild Attacks
- Oral analgesics and NSAIDs are effective in about 50-70% of cases
- Aspirin, acetaminophen (paracetamol), ibuprofen, naproxen are first-line options
- The FDA-approved combination of acetaminophen + aspirin + caffeine (e.g., Excedrin) is effective for mild-to-moderate migraine. Caffeine aids absorption, helps induce vasoconstriction, and reduces serotonergic brainstem neuron firing
- Aspirin + metoclopramide is another validated combination
- A stratified care model (choosing medication based on severity and disability from the start) has been shown superior to a step-up approach (starting with NSAID and escalating)
Moderate-to-Severe Attacks
Triptans are the preferred first-line migraine-specific agents. If nonspecific analgesics fail or pain is severe from onset, move directly to triptans.
Drug Classes in Detail
1. Triptans (5-HT1B/1D Receptor Agonists) - FIRST LINE
Available agents: sumatriptan, rizatriptan, zolmitriptan, almotriptan, eletriptan, naratriptan, frovatriptan
Mechanism: Activate 5-HT1B/1D receptors on small peripheral nerves innervating intracranial vasculature → cranial vasoconstriction + inhibition of pro-inflammatory neuropeptide release from the trigeminal system (substance P, CGRP). Effective in migraine with or without aura.
Efficacy: Abort or markedly reduce severity in ~70% of patients
Routes: Sumatriptan is available SC, intranasal, and oral. Zolmitriptan: oral or nasal spray. Others: oral only.
- SC sumatriptan onset: ~20 min
- Oral onset: 1-2 hours
Important pharmacokinetics:

Repeat dosing: A second dose at 2 hours is not effective for triptans (unlike gepants). If medication is required within 60 min because symptoms haven't abated, increase the initial dose for subsequent attacks or switch drug class.
Contraindications: Uncontrolled hypertension, ischemic heart disease, coronary artery spasm, prior stroke/TIA, hemiplegic or basilar migraine, peripheral vascular disease, pregnancy. Cardiac evaluation required before use in patients with risk factors for CAD.
Adverse effects: Pressure/tightness in chest, neck, throat, jaw; dizziness; malaise; elevated blood pressure. Sumatriptan/naproxen fixed-dose combination is also available.
2. Ergot Alkaloids (5-HT1 + α + Dopamine Receptor Agonist)
- Ergotamine: Sublingual or oral + caffeine tablet/suppository. Most effective in early stages. Strict daily and weekly dose limits due to dependence and rebound headaches.
- Dihydroergotamine (DHE): IV or intranasal. Efficacy similar to sumatriptan. Reserved for severe migraine. Nausea is a common adverse effect.
Contraindications: Angina, peripheral vascular disease (significant vasoconstrictors). Do not use within 24 hours of triptans (risk of coronary ischemia). Contraindicated with potent CYP3A4 inhibitors (risk of life-threatening peripheral ischemia).
3. Ditans (5-HT1F Receptor Agonists) - Newer Class
- Lasmiditan - selective 5-HT1F agonist
- Thought to reduce activation of trigeminal nerve pain pathways
- Does not cause vasoconstriction - advantage over triptans/ergots
- Indicated for acute migraine when triptans are contraindicated or not tolerated (e.g., significant cardiovascular disease)
- Classified as a controlled substance (abuse potential)
- Can cause significant driving impairment - patients should avoid hazardous activities
- Oral route
4. CGRP Receptor Antagonists (Gepants) - Newer Class
- Rimegepant and ubrogepant - both oral
- CGRP levels are elevated during acute migraine and contribute to neurogenic inflammation
- Indicated for acute migraine when triptans are contraindicated or not tolerated
- Repeat dosing is effective (unlike triptans) - can re-dose at 2 hours
- Rimegepant can also be used for migraine prevention (as can atogepant)
- Adverse effects: nausea, somnolence (low incidence)
- Ubrogepant is contraindicated with strong CYP3A4 inhibitors
5. Antiemetics / Dopamine Receptor Antagonists
Key role in acute migraine because:
- Nausea and vomiting are common symptoms
- Once attack is fully developed, oral drugs are less effective due to decreased GI motility and poor absorption
Agents used:
- Metoclopramide (also has pro-kinetic effect improving absorption of co-administered drugs)
- Prochlorperazine
- Domperidone
These can be used as monotherapy for mild attacks or in combination with triptans/NSAIDs for moderate-severe attacks. The combination of an NSAID + triptan/ergot + dopamine antagonist antiemetic (rational polytherapy) targets multiple substrates of migraine pathophysiology and is more effective than single-agent treatment.
Route of Administration
| Severity | Preferred Route |
|---|
| Mild - moderate, no vomiting | Oral |
| Nausea/vomiting present | Intranasal, SC injection, PR suppository |
| Severe / Status migrainosus | IV/parenteral |
Emergency Department / Status Migrainosus
For refractory or severe attacks:
- IV metoclopramide or prochlorperazine (dopamine antagonists) - first-line in ED
- IV DHE (dihydroergotamine) after antiemetic pretreatment
- IV valproic acid - loading dose 15 mg/kg at 20 mg/min in D5W, followed by 5 mg/kg q8h; an alternative is 1 g in 250 mL NS over 1 hour
- IV/IM ketorolac (NSAID)
- Dexamethasone 10 mg IV before discharge to prevent headache recurrence
- Opioids/opiates should be avoided to minimize risk of medication overuse headache

Non-Pharmacologic Measures
- Rest in a dark, quiet room with ice pack on the head
- Sleep often resolves the attack
- Trigger identification and avoidance
- Stress management: biofeedback, yoga, transcendental meditation
- Regular sleep, meals, exercise, limiting caffeine and alcohol
Practical Prescribing Tips
- Start treatment early - at first symptom or during aura rather than waiting for full headache
- Use adequate dosing - under-dosing is a common failure mode
- Choose route based on associated symptoms - vomiting means oral drugs won't work
- Warn about medication overuse headache (MOH) - limit acute drug use to ≤10-15 days/month depending on agent
- Triptans are ineffective for prevention - treat the acute attack only
- Try multiple triptans before concluding the class doesn't work - individual response varies significantly
Summary of Drug Choice by Clinical Scenario
| Scenario | Drug of Choice |
|---|
| Mild-moderate attack, no nausea | NSAIDs, aspirin+acetaminophen+caffeine |
| Moderate-severe attack | Triptan (oral) |
| Severe attack with vomiting | SC sumatriptan, intranasal zolmitriptan, DHE intranasal |
| CVD/cardiac risk factors, can't use triptans | Lasmiditan or gepants (rimegepant/ubrogepant) |
| Emergency department | IV prochlorperazine or metoclopramide ± IV ketorolac |
| Status migrainosus | IV DHE, IV valproate, dexamethasone |
